脂蛋白脂酶基因S447X多态性与糖尿病关系的Meta分析

摘    要:目的 探讨脂蛋白脂酶(LPL)基因S447X多态性与糖尿病(DM)易感性之间的关联。方法 检索PubMed、OvidSP、CBM、中国知网和万方数据,收集关于LPL S447X多态性与DM的病例-对照研究,2名评价者按筛选标准分析文献,提取资料,质量评价,并完成Meta分析和试验序贯分析(TSA)。结果 9篇文献被纳入Meta分析,2型DM(T2DM)患者G等位基因(OR = 0.66,95% CI为0.48 ~ 0.90,P = 0.01)和CG基因型(OR = 0.63,95% CI为0.43 ~ 0.91,P = 0.02)频率比对照组降低。TSA结果显示显性模型的累积Z值跨越传统界值线、TSA界值线和RIS线。与CC基因型相比,CG+GG基因型DM患者TG、TC和LDL - C水平降低,而HDL - C水平升高。结论 LPL基因S447X多态性G等位基因和CG基因型是T2DM的保护因素,可改善脂代谢异常而降低T2DM的患病风险。

Meta-analysis on the correlation between S447X polymorphism of lipoprotein lipase gene and diabetes mellitus

Abstract:Objective To investigate the relationship between S447X polymorphism of lipoprotein lipase(LPL) gene and diabetes mellitus(DM). Methods Databases including PubMed, OvidSP, CBM, CNKI and Wanfang were searched to collect all case-control studies on the association between LPL S447X polymorphism and DM. According to the selection criteria, 2 reviewers screened the literatures, extracted data, evaluated the quality, and performed Meta-analysis and trial sequential analysis (TSA). Results Nine studies were collected into Meta-analysis. The frequencies of G allele (OR=0.66, 95%CI 0.48-0.90, P=0.01) and CG genotype (OR=0.63, 95%CI 0.43-0.91, P=0.02) in type 2 DM (T2DM) patients were significantly lower than those in the control group. TSA showed that the cumulative Z values of dominant model had already crossed the traditional boundary line, TSA threshold value line and RIS line. Compared with CC genotype, TG TC and LDL-C levels were decreased and HDL-C levels were increased in CG+GG genotype DM patients. Conclusion The G allele and CG genotype of LPL gene S447X polymorphism are protective factors for T2DM. The CG+GG genotype can improve the abnormalities of lipid metabolism and reduce the risk of T2DM.
